Overview

This role involves performing field inspections, engineering design work, and supporting construction activities within the utility distribution sector. The engineer will collaborate with various stakeholders to ensure standards are met and assist in troubleshooting outages.

Responsibilities

  • Review work provided by client and assess scope requirements
  • Conduct field inspections and collect data
  • Provide engineering support during construction and post-construction reviews
  • Perform root cause analysis of outages and implement mitigation strategies
  • Travel locally and regionally up to 10%, perform site visits, and gather field data to assist in design development
  • Ensure compliance with engineering and construction standards

Qualifications

  • High school diploma or equivalent required; associates in engineering technology or related field preferred
  • Willingness to perform both field and office work
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ills
  • Proficiency in MS Office applications (Word, Excel, Outlook)
  • Valid US driver’s license required for travel
  • Power/utilities experience preferred
  • Previous experience with field data collection preferred
